On Thursday, host of 'Tucker on Twitter' Tucker Carlson released a lengthy 45 minute interview with GOP rising star and the youngest presidential candidate in the 2024 field Vivek Ramaswamy.
"Vivek Ramaswamy is the youngest Republican presidential candidate ever," Carlson wrote with the attached interview. "He's worth listening to."
The interview opened with a focus on Vivek's insistence on challenging the dominant narrative with Vivek pointing to his recent comments on 9/11.
The interview then turned to the ongoing economic downturn with the candidate explaining that he expects the economy to go towards a recession within the next year. He added that he believes that a revolution, in the positive sense, is on the horizon.
Tucker then asked Ramaswamy about comments he made about big dollar donors and how he was surprised that his stance on Ukraine turned away many GOP donors, a fact that he found surprising.
Vivek went on to explain that the expansion of NATO has caused Russia to pursue an alliance with China and that his lack of foreign policy experience may actually be an advantage.
He also explained that the United States should focus on achieving semi conductor independence in order to move away from indefinitely being tied to Taiwan given that a future invasion by the People's Republic of China is likely.
Vivek then moved to his idea of reinstating a modern "Monroe Doctrine" in order to defend the homeland and laid out his foreign policy vision.
The conversation then moved to a recent conversation Vivek had with a pansexual reporter in Iowa which went viral earlier this week. The conversation, where Vivek argued that a tyranny of the minority is currently underway in America, showed how he was able to challenge the original combative question.
